C128 NetLex

Commodore 128 Bedienungshandbuch
Commodore 128 System Guide



ASC-Funktion

Format: v=ASC(x$)

Zweck: Liefert einen numerischen, ganzzahligen Wert zwischen 0  und 255, der den ASCII-Code des ersten Zeichens der  Zeichenkette x$ repräsentiert. Ist x$ eine Zeichenkette der Länge 0 (Leerstring), so wird eine ILLEGAL QUANTITY-Fehlermeldung ausgegeben.

Bemerkungen: Hinweis: Die ASC-Funktion wird im Handbuch nur für den C64-Modus korrekt beschrieben. Im C128-Modus ergibt eine Zeichenkette der Länge 0 (Leerstring) keinen Fehler, sondern liefert als Funktionsergebnis den Wert 0.

Beispiele: 10 A$="TEST"
20 PRINT(A$)
RUN
84
READY.

PRINT ASC("")
? ILLEGAL QUANTITY  ERROR
READY

Neue Funktionsweise im C128-Modus:

PRINT ASC("")
0
READY



Auszug aus dem Commodore C128 (D) Bedienungshandbuch: Seite 5-3
Ergänzt um die Bemerkung und Beispiele zum Leerstring von WTE


[Seitenanfang] [Infos] [Links] [Lexikon] [Home]
Erstellt von WTE, am 09. Oktober 2011; überarbeitet am 09. Oktober 2011